And as Dan Patterson says, you can rebuild the car yourself (well, I guess I'm not sure if this is rebuilding or getting one prebuilt. It makes a prj file, that's all I know):
prj = open(r"C:\junk\my_new_prj_file.prj", "w")
crs_string = 'PROJCS["NAD_1983_UTM_Zone_10N",GEOGCS["GCS_North_American_1983",DATUM["D_North_American_1983",SPHEROID["GRS_1980",6378137,298.257222101]],PRIMEM["Greenwich",0],UNIT["Degree",0.017453292519943295]],PROJECTION["Transverse_Mercator"],PARAMETER["latitude_of_origin",0],PARAMETER["central_meridian",-123],PARAMETER["scale_factor",0.9996],PARAMETER["false_easting",500000],PARAMETER["false_northing",0],UNIT["Meter",1]]'
prj.write(crs_string)
prj.close()
